Perhaps they are able to compete _because_ they are innovating.
If Kobo would only do 6 inch readers, there would only be the following reasons to buy a Kobo:

- You want more font options
- You don't want to buy books at Amazon (assuming you're not going to deDRM and use Calibre)

And in going for a Kobo, you get a loss less text than a Kindle, because of the large header and footer (assuming you're not going to patch and hack CSS using Calibre and stuff.)

With the 6.8-7.8 inch readers, Kobo has something that Amazon does not, and that is a *very* good reason to look at them.
